Welcome Guest ( Log In | Register )

Bump Topic Topic Closed RSS Feed

Outline · [ Standard ] · Linear+

 New iTunes users please read this, itms protocol not recognized

views
     
TSevilhomura89
post Feb 4 2009, 03:23 PM, updated 17y ago

Look at all my stars!!
*******
Senior Member
5,886 posts

Joined: Jan 2003
From: BM


QUOTE
Apparently when iTunes installed on Windows Vista it didn't properly associate the itms protocol. So when I click on a store link from a web browser it brings up an error in Firefox about the itms protocol not being associated with an application. Similarly a link in IE7 will just redirect to the iTunes download page.


-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=
SOLUTION AS FOLLOWS:

NOTE: As always back up your system restore point and make a
copy of the registry or the sections of the registry
you are editing!!!
-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=

You need permissions set to the following registry paths under

HKEY_CLASSES_ROOT\itms\shell\open\command
HKEY_CLASSES_ROOT\itmss\shell\open\command
HKEY_CLASSES_ROOT\itpc\shell\open\command

You may not see these as you reset permissions and have to go as far as adding a new key under each registry key, then it will show you your newly added key (just delete) and then set the appropriate permissions to administrators group on each until you get down to the "command" key.

Then once you are in the command key edit the following string that should show

C:\Program Files\iTunes\iTunes.exe /url "%1"

and change it to...

"C:\Program Files\iTunes\iTunes.exe" /url "%1"


yes I know, ridiculous that it is a matter of quotes missing, but that is what fixed it for me.

-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=

From http://discussions.apple.com/message.jspa?messageID=5598778

The process is a little tedious but it will fix the problem.
U'll need to click the registry key and go to Edit -> Permission -> Advanced -> Owners -> Change owner to the current users
Then right click the key and go to permission and tick "Full Control" under Allow column
When moving from HKEY_CLASSES_ROOT\itms to HKEY_CLASSES_ROOT\itms\shell to HKEY_CLASSES_ROOT\itms\shell\open etc
You need to right click \itms -> "New Key" to reveal the \shell then repeat the process above until you reach HKEY_CLASSES_ROOT\itpc\shell\open\command and edit the string.


EDITED
No more tedious process
Please refer to post #4 for better solution.

This post has been edited by evilhomura89: Feb 4 2009, 10:23 PM
dvlzplayground
post Feb 4 2009, 04:15 PM

Web developer Nadzim.com
*******
Senior Member
7,916 posts

Joined: Jul 2005
From: Kuala Lumpur


Good job TS smile.gif
viledante
post Feb 4 2009, 06:55 PM

Casual
***
Junior Member
414 posts

Joined: Nov 2007
From: Perlis

weird, I'm a vista user and nothing happen to me.
neway, thanks for the tips, will be my future reference incase in need nod.gif
TSevilhomura89
post Feb 4 2009, 10:07 PM

Look at all my stars!!
*******
Senior Member
5,886 posts

Joined: Jan 2003
From: BM


I found a better fix here for editing the permission.
http://f0vela.wordpress.com/2008/07/22/fix...dating-problem/
after the permission edit, then go edit the missing quote...


Added on February 4, 2009, 10:15 pmall the affected protocol where the quotes are missing
HKEY_CLASSES_ROOT\itms\shell\open\command
HKEY_CLASSES_ROOT\itmss\shell\open\command
HKEY_CLASSES_ROOT\itpc\shell\open\command
HKEY_CLASSES_ROOT\daap\shell\open\command
HKEY_CLASSES_ROOT\pcast\shell\open\command


This post has been edited by evilhomura89: Feb 4 2009, 10:15 PM
Mgsrulz
post Feb 4 2009, 10:21 PM

30 years of Metal Gear
********
All Stars
14,258 posts

Joined: Mar 2005


only encountered it once,and my firefox just popped up asking me to look for the program.

but good tips regardless rclxms.gif

Topic ClosedOptions
 

Change to:
| Lo-Fi Version
0.0153sec    0.32    5 queries    GZIP Disabled
Time is now: 12th December 2025 - 04:33 AM